Delhi Police has arrested two terror accused, including a juvenile, in connection with the May 9 RPG attack at Punjab Police headquarters in Mohali. The juvenile was also tasked with "eliminating" actor Salman Khan, police said.
Apart from the juvenile, the Special Cell of the Delhi Police has arrested another man, identified as Arshdeep Singh, in connection with the recovery of an Improvised Explosive Device (IED) in Haryana on August 4, police said.
According to the police, the Lawrence Bishnoi and Jaggu Bhagwanpuria syndicate tasked the juvenile along with Deepak Surakpur (presently in hiding) and Monu Dagar (in jail) with "eliminating" actor Salman Khan.
On May 9, a rocket-propelled grenade was fired at the Punjab Police's intelligence headquarters in Mohali.
